Brazing of Sn78Cu22 on aluminum substrates observed via in-situ experiments in a large-chamber SEM
Abstract In situ brazing is a powerful method for understanding dynamic material behavior during joining process, enabling real-time observation of melting, wetting, and interfacial reactions. The present study investigates the influence of aluminum alloy chemical composition on wetting behavior and...
